Introduction to Leopard Diets

Leopards are carnivores, belonging to the family Felidae. Their diet primarily consists of meat, which they obtain by hunting a variety of prey. The leopard’s diet is not limited to a single type of animal but rather encompasses a broad spectrum of species, from small rodents to larger ungulates. This adaptability in their diet is a key factor in their widespread distribution across different habitats and geographical locations.

Prey Selection and Preferences

The choice of prey for leopards is influenced by several factors, including the availability of the prey, the leopard’s energetic needs, and the risk associated with hunting different species. Prey size is a crucial determinant, as leopards tend to prefer prey that is large enough to provide a substantial meal but not so large that it poses a significant hunting risk. In many leopard habitats, antelopes and impalas are common prey, offering a good balance between size and the energy required for the hunt.

Dietary Variations Across Habitats

The leopard’s favourite food can vary significantly depending on its geographical location and the local fauna. For instance, leopards inhabiting areas with dense forests and abundant small game might prefer monkeys and bush pigs, whereas those in more open savannas and grasslands may opt for gazelles and duikers. This adaptability in their diet is crucial for their survival, allowing them to thrive in diverse ecosystems.

The Hunting Strategy of Leopards

Leopards are notorious for their stealth and agility, characteristics that make them formidable hunters. Their approach to hunting is largely solitary and nocturnal, utilizing their excellent night vision and powerful legs to ambush prey. The success of their hunting strategy is closely linked to their favourite food sources, as they tend to focus on prey that is both abundant and vulnerable to their ambush tactics.

Factors Influencing Food Choice

Several factors influence a leopard’s food choice, including:

  • Seasonal Availability: The availability of certain prey species can fluctuate with the seasons, affecting the leopard’s diet. For example, in areas where certain ungulates migrate seasonally, leopards may adjust their hunting strategies to target these transient prey populations.
  • Habitat Structure: The physical characteristics of the leopard’s habitat, such as forest density or the presence of rocky outcrops, can influence their ability to hunt certain prey.
  • Human Activity: In some regions, human activities like agriculture, urbanization, and hunting can alter the availability of prey species, forcing leopards to adapt their dietary preferences.

Impact of Human-Wildlife Conflict

The encroachment of human settlements into leopard habitats has led to an increase in human-wildlife conflict, where leopards may begin to view domestic livestock as a convenient food source. This shift in their diet can lead to retaliatory killings by humans, threatening leopard populations. Understanding and addressing these conflicts through conservation efforts is crucial for preserving leopard populations and maintaining the balance of their ecosystems.

How do leopards hunt their prey?

Leopards are skilled hunters that use a variety of techniques to catch their prey. They are nocturnal animals, meaning they do most of their hunting at night, when their prey is most active. Leopards use their exceptional night vision, acute hearing, and powerful sense of smell to stalk and locate their prey. They are stealthy and agile, able to creep up on their prey undetected and then use their speed and power to chase and catch it. Leopards are also climbers, and they often use trees to stalk and ambush their prey.

The leopard’s hunting technique is highly efficient, with a success rate of around 50%. They typically hunt alone, using cover and concealment to get close to their prey. Once they have stalked their prey, leopards use a burst of speed to chase and catch it, often targeting the throat or neck to deliver a fatal bite. After killing their prey, leopards often drag it to a safe location, such as a tree or a thicket, where they can feed on it without being disturbed. This solitary and opportunistic hunting style allows leopards to thrive in a variety of environments and to maintain their position as top predators in their ecosystems.

What is the significance of scavenging in a leopard’s diet?

Scavenging plays a significant role in a leopard’s diet, particularly in areas where prey is scarce or competition is high. Leopards are opportunistic feeders, and they will eat carrion if they come across it. Scavenging allows leopards to supplement their diet with essential nutrients and energy, especially during times of food scarcity. By feeding on carrion, leopards can also reduce their energy expenditure on hunting, which is beneficial in environments where prey is hard to find.

Scavenging also provides leopards with an opportunity to feed on prey that they may not have been able to catch themselves. For example, leopards may feed on the carcasses of large animals like elephants or hippos, which are difficult to hunt and kill. By scavenging, leopards can access a wider range of prey and maintain their nutritional needs, even in areas where their preferred prey is scarce. However, scavenging also carries risks, such as the risk of disease transmission or competition with other scavengers. Overall, scavenging is an important adaptation that allows leopards to survive and thrive in a variety of environments.

Do leopards have a preference for certain types of prey?

Yes, leopards do have a preference for certain types of prey. In general, leopards tend to prefer prey that is small to medium-sized, such as antelopes, gazelles, and impalas. These animals are abundant in many leopard habitats and provide a reliable source of food. Leopards also tend to prefer prey that is vulnerable or weakened, such as young, old, or injured animals. By targeting these animals, leopards can increase their hunting success and reduce their energy expenditure.

The leopard’s preference for certain types of prey is also influenced by the availability of food in their environment. For example, in areas where small prey is abundant, leopards may focus on hunting these animals. In areas where larger prey is more abundant, leopards may shift their focus to hunting larger animals. Additionally, leopards may also develop a preference for certain types of prey based on their experience and learning. For example, a leopard that has successfully hunted a particular species of antelope may develop a preference for that species over time. This adaptability in their diet allows leopards to optimize their hunting strategy and maintain their nutritional needs in a variety of environments.
